How Master Cylinders Work: Mechanisms and Functions
Master cylinders, a critical component in vehicle braking systems, are responsible for amplifying the force applied by the driver’s brakes through hydraulic pressure. Located in the brake master cylinder assembly, this mechanism operates by translating the linear motion of the brake pedal into the necessary hydraulic pressure to engage the car’s brakes. In vehicles, especially those seeking robust performance like 4x4s in Brownsville, Tx, understanding how master cylinders work is essential for ensuring optimal braking efficiency and safety.
The process begins when the driver presses the brake pedal. This motion actuates a piston within the master cylinder, which forces fluid through a set of hydraulic lines towards the wheel brakes. The force multiplication effect arises from the principle of hydraulic pressure—the greater the area over which pressure is applied, the higher the resulting pressure. This allows even a moderate brake application by the driver to generate sufficient force to slow or stop the vehicle’s wheels effectively. Common Issues and Troubleshooting Tips for Master Cylinders
Master cylinders, essential components in vehicles, especially those with 4×4 capabilities in Brownsville, Tx, can encounter various issues that impact performance and safety. Common problems include reduced brake power, pedal pulsation, or a soft brake feel. These may stem from contaminated brake fluid, worn cylinder pistons, or damaged seals allowing air into the system.
Troubleshooting these issues requires a systematic approach. Check for proper brake fluid levels and ensure there’s no contamination. Inspect the master cylinder itself for leaks or damage. Replace any faulty components, such as worn pistons or worn out seals. Bleed the system if air has entered to restore optimal performance. Maintenance and Longevity: Ensuring Smooth Performance of Your Master Cylinder
Master cylinders are essential components in vehicles, particularly for those with off-road capabilities or 4×4 systems. Regular maintenance is crucial to ensure their longevity and optimal performance, especially in demanding driving conditions like those found in Brownsville, Tx’s rugged terrain. One of the key aspects of maintenance is keeping the master cylinder fluid in top condition. Over time, this fluid can become contaminated with debris, leading to reduced efficiency and potential damage. Regularly checking and changing the fluid according to the vehicle manufacturer’s recommendations is vital for smooth operation.
Additionally, inspecting the master cylinder itself for any signs of wear or damage is essential. Leaks, corrosion, or warping can all impact its performance.
